为什么 lua 在游戏开发中应用普遍?
- 发表时间:2025-06-26 19:10:16
- 来源:
因为 QuickJS 这样的东西没有早出来几年,否则根本没有 Lua 什么事情,归根揭底,Lua 并不是一门好语言: 作用域默认是 global 的,不是 local 的,但凡最近三十年发明的语言,变量和函数定义基本都是默认 local 的作用域 ,lua 这种默认 global 的设计,强迫你到处写满 local,简直是一口气直追 50 年前的古圣先贤。
索引从 1 开始:记忆里只有 Pascal / QBasic 是这么做的,但 pascal 事实上允许索引从任意位置开始(从 0 / 1 …。
推荐资讯
- 2025-06-21 15:25:16印度女性为什么不嫁到中国?
- 2025-06-21 15:15:18网传西藏六月发生三起藏马熊吃人***,藏马熊真的这么可怕吗?
- 2025-06-21 15:35:17如何看待 Rust 的应用前景?
- 2025-06-21 16:15:17养乌龟如何降低换水频率?
- 2025-06-21 15:40:17能分享一下你写过的rust项目吗?
- 2025-06-21 15:00:17PHP现在真的已经过时了吗?
- 2025-06-21 16:10:16为什么程序员独爱用Mac进行编程?
- 2025-06-21 15:55:17国产手机AI「好用」的背后,是技术差距还是文化差异?
- 2025-06-21 14:50:18为什么windows的arm版没有被广泛使用?
- 2025-06-21 16:20:17大家支不支持文言文,古文退出中国教育?
推荐产品
-
皮肤太白是种怎样的体验?
大概就是 只要给我一点光 我就是灯泡! 废话不多说,直接上图 -
Rust 的设计缺陷是什么?
刚看上一个大佬回答的评论区,我认为其实Rust最核心的设计缺 -
为什么不用rust重写Nginx?
cloudflare 已经重写了,他们认为 NGINX 有一 -
如果你是《一帘幽梦》里的绿萍,你会不会最后原谅紫菱?
有的人不会思考是否原谅这种问题,因为他们就不会后悔。 昨天
新闻动态
最新资讯